Timing/Spacing
This project was a timing and spacing exercise. It demonstartes the techniques of the following movements: linear, ease in and out, easae out, ease in, overshoot and settle, and vibrate.
The examples in the video all start and end at the same point. The speeds of travel are all uniquely different. These movements will be encorporated in future annimations to display realistic or unreal motion.
